Enabling Technologies Corp — New website leads to phenomenal visitor increases

Enabling Technologies Corp, a Microsoft Gold Partner, is a fast-growing global IT consulting practice focused on providing messaging solutions for medium and large enterprises.

The IT firm, the 2009 Microsoft Unified Communications Solutions Award winner, recently turned to Intellicore Design Consulting to design a new website and the results are phenomenal.

The new site recently scored 1,414 visitors between May 1 through July 15, 2009 — and this is 1078% of the total visitors in the entire previous 6 months. Enabling has also captured 144 conversions — Contact Us requests — during the same 45-day period, up from about 12 per year with the old site.

How social media helps customer service - Up close examples

I just bought a new cell phone – starting with an AT&T Pantech Matrix Pro before switching to an iPhone.  My goal, beyond making phone calls, was to download emails from multiple email accounts, send text messages, and Twitter.

Guess what?  I experienced configuration problems.  No surprise there, what with a new phone and all. Besides, that’s what tech support is for.

In trying to solve my problems, though, I experienced an up close and personal view in how three companies – AT&T, Pantech, and Rackspace Email – use Twitter’s social media channel to their benefit...or in the case of one company, to its detriment.

How communication styles impact collaboration

I love my mother but some conversations with her drives me crazy.  She needs to explain everything is in excruciating detail, even when I get it, or she provides me with such a minutia of detail that I lose sight of her point.  She can take 5 minutes what it takes me 15 seconds to convey.

The reason?  She and I have conflicting communication styles that require us to work hard to adjust for each others.

While that’s a personal example, variations in communication styles directly impact in the business world and on the ease of collaboration within a group.

There are four primary styles of communication.  Different folks have variable names for them but I playfully call the styles Airheads, Firebrands, Waterways, and Earthworks. Let’s explore how each style is conveyed and the stylistic impacts on social media and internal collaboration.
